My Friend Derek's occupies a small storefront in Tangletown, Wallingford, serving Detroit-style pizza. The place started as an underground operation — pies baked in a home oven and run out to people waiting in their cars — before becoming a permanent shop on N 55th Street.

Pizza runs the show most of the week, with specials, salads, and a list of cheap beer, wine, and spritzes rounding things out. On weekends, the focaccia sandwiches take over for lunch and have built their own following alongside the pizza.

Regulars point to the quality of the pies and the friendliness of the staff as reasons to squeeze into the small space, even when seating runs tight. The Infatuation scored it 8.8/10.
